Solution Overview
Problem
Power generation devices, such as wind turbines, face challenges in accurately assessing their condition due to incomplete or unavailability of troubleshooting documentation, leading to unnecessary maintenance and safety risks.
Innovation Solution
A troubleshooting response synthesis system that predicts fault stacks and generates synthesized documentation by leveraging historical data, machine-learning algorithms, and language processing to provide operators with accurate and comprehensible maintenance instructions.

Data Source
AI summary
A system for synthesizing fault response documentation for power generation devices includes troubleshooting response synthesis circuitry configured to identify a fault stack based on monitored conditions at a first power generation device. The troubleshooting response synthesis circuitry may supplant missing documentation with documentation for power generation devices of a different type from the first power generation device. Language processing and translation is used to construct synthesized documentation for the first power generation device based on the documentation for power generation devices of a different type from the first power generation device. The synthesized documentation is used with generative language processing to generate troubleshooting response messages for faults in the identified fault stack.
